Anecdote: I live in Palo Alto, and my entire neighborhood is on Comcast. In January, service got to be really bad, 1Mbs upload during the day. Comcast came out, said our local node was saturated at 92%, and that they have an upgrade planned a year from now, and that we can suck it till then. This is Palo Alto, the land of very vocal neighbors. They started a campaign where we all sent a complaint to the FCC. Within a week, we were personally contacted by a Comcast rep, techs came out, and suddenly I had 30Mbs up. And Comcast reps have been calling, emailing every week to make sure we are ok. Not sure what happened, the node did not get upgraded, but they fixed something. And another data point on how sad the situation is in the US: my brother lives in Belgrade, Serbia, in one of those concrete high-rises from the 70s. He got fiber this year from a private company, and his speeds beat mine, and it is dirt cheap. There is no logical explanation for the fact that his internet speeds beat mine, and I am a mile away from Google HQ. |
